Abstract

The invention provides an information viewing method and electronic equipment, wherein the method comprises the following steps: receiving touch operation of a user on a target application program icon in a preset interface; acquiring detailed information of an application program corresponding to a target application program icon according to touch operation; and displaying the detailed information on the target interface. The embodiment of the invention can directly enter the detailed information interface corresponding to the target application program through simple steps, so that the operation is simple, the time consumption is short, and the operation efficiency is high when the detailed information of the application program corresponding to the target application program icon is checked.

Background
At present, electronic devices are completely popularized, more and more applications are installed on the electronic devices, and when there are dozens of applications on the electronic devices, the operation steps of the application detail page are usually: entering a setting interface, clicking more setting options, clicking options corresponding to application management in interfaces corresponding to the more setting options, searching a target application program in the application management interface, clicking the target application program, and entering a detailed interface of the target application program.
Obviously, the existing method is complex to operate and long in time consumption, and a user cannot quickly check the detailed information of the target application program, so that the use experience of the user is influenced.
Disclosure of Invention
The embodiment of the invention provides an information viewing method and electronic equipment, and aims to solve the problem that operation for viewing detailed information of a target application program is complex in the prior art.

Example one
Referring to fig. 1, a flowchart illustrating steps of an information viewing method according to a first embodiment of the present invention is shown.
The information viewing method provided by the embodiment of the invention comprises the following steps:
step 101: and receiving touch operation of a user on a target application program icon in a preset interface.
It should be noted that the preset interface may be a desktop of the electronic device, a control center interface, a recent task interface, and an application search interface. Fig. 2 is a control center interface.
It should be noted that the touch operation may be a sliding operation, a pressing operation, a double-click operation, a single-click operation, and the like on the target application icon, which is not specifically limited in this embodiment of the present invention.
Step 102: and acquiring the detailed information of the application program corresponding to the target application program icon according to the touch operation.
According to the touch operation, determining the detail information of the application program corresponding to the target application program from the electronic device, wherein the detail information of the application program may include: the information of the storage position of the application program, the information of the authorization authority of the application program, the information of the memory occupied by the application program, the version information of the application program, the information of the affiliated developer of the application program and the like.
Step 103: and displaying the detailed information on the target interface.
The target interface can be a currently displayed preset interface, and can also jump to the target interface from the preset interface, so that a user can directly and simply operate to quickly obtain the detailed information of the application program corresponding to the target application program icon, and the detailed information of the application program corresponding to the target application program icon does not need to be searched layer by layer from the setting interface.

Example two
Referring to fig. 3, a flowchart illustrating steps of an information viewing method according to a second embodiment of the present invention is shown.
The information viewing method provided by the embodiment of the invention comprises the following steps:
step 201: and acquiring the display times of different display modes when the user views the detailed information of each application program in the electronic equipment.
The history display data of the detail information of each application is data used when the detail information of each application is viewed in a preset time period, and for example: the user slides a setting option of the control center interface to enter a detail display interface of the target application program, namely, the historical display data is the detail information of the single-screen display application program, or when the user views the detail information of the target application program, the electronic equipment displays the detail information in a split screen mode when the electronic equipment is a single screen mode, or when the electronic equipment is two screens, the detail information is displayed on a first screen or a second screen, and how to display the detail information of the application program is the historical display data of the detail information of each application program.
Before step 201, when the preset interface is an application program search interface, a search operation of a user on the application program search interface is received. And responding to the searching operation, acquiring each application program icon corresponding to the searching operation, and displaying on an application program searching interface.
And when the preset interface is the application program searching interface, receiving the searching operation of the user on the application program searching interface. The user can input a name of a target application program to be searched in an input box of the application program searching interface, corresponding application program icons are displayed on the application program searching interface according to the name of the target application program, the type of the application program can be input in the application program searching interface, and a plurality of application program icons corresponding to the type are determined according to the type of the input application program.
When the electronic device has one screen, the history display mode comprises the following steps: and displaying the detailed information on a single screen or displaying the detailed information on a split screen.
It should be noted that, a person skilled in the art may set the preset time period, which may be set to be one week, one month, two months, or the like, and the embodiment of the present invention is not limited to this specifically.
Step 202: and determining the display mode with the highest display frequency as the target display mode.
For example, when the number of times of displaying the detailed information of the application program on the single screen is the highest, the target history display mode is the detailed information of the application program displayed on the single screen, when the number of times of displaying the detailed information on the split screen is the highest, the target history display mode is the detailed information displayed on the split screen, when the number of times of displaying the detailed information on the first screen is the highest, the target history display mode is the detailed information displayed on the first screen, and when the number of times of displaying the detailed information on the second screen is the highest, the target history display mode is the detailed information displayed on the second screen.
By determining the classification with the highest frequency, the mode of the final user when viewing the detailed information of the target application program is determined, and the user does not need to set which screen to display, and the display can be performed directly according to the historical display mode of the user.
In addition to this, the user can manually perform the setting.
Step 203: and receiving touch operation of a user on a target application program icon in a preset interface.
It should be noted that the preset interface may be a desktop of the electronic device, a control center interface, a recent task interface, and an application search interface.
It should be noted that the touch operation may be an up-sliding operation, a down-sliding operation, a left-sliding operation, a right-sliding operation, a pressing operation, a double-click operation, a single-click operation, and the like on the target application icon, which is not limited in this embodiment of the present invention.
Step 204: and acquiring the detailed information of the application program corresponding to the target application program icon according to the touch operation.
According to the touch operation, determining the detail information of the application program corresponding to the target application program from the electronic device, wherein the detail information of the application program may include: the information of the storage position of the application program, the information of the authorization authority of the application program, the information of the memory occupied by the application program, the version information of the application program, the information of the affiliated developer of the application program and the like.
Step 205: and displaying the detailed information on a target display interface according to the target display mode.
By determining the classification with the highest frequency, the mode of the final user when viewing the detailed information of the target application program is determined, and the user does not need to set which screen to display, and the display can be performed directly according to the historical display mode of the user.

The electronic device 500 also includes at least one sensor 505, such as light sensors, motion sensors, and other sensors. Specifically, the light sensor includes an ambient light sensor that can adjust the brightness of the display panel 5061 according to the brightness of ambient light, and a proximity sensor that can turn off the display panel 5061 and/or a backlight when the electronic device 500 is moved to the ear. As one type of motion sensor, an accelerometer sensor can detect the magnitude of acceleration in each direction (generally three axes), detect the magnitude and direction of gravity when stationary, and can be used to identify the posture of an electronic device (such as horizontal and vertical screen switching, related games, magnetometer posture calibration), and vibration identification related functions (such as pedometer, tapping); the sensors 505 may also include fingerprint sensors, pressure sensors, iris sensors, molecular sensors, gyroscopes, barometers, hygrometers, thermometers, infrared sensors, etc., which are not described in detail herein.
The display unit 506 is used to display information input by the user or information provided to the user. The Display unit 506 may include a Display panel 5061, and the Display panel 5061 may be configured in the form of a Liquid Crystal Display (LCD), an Organic Light-Emitting Diode (OLED), or the like.
The user input unit 507 may be used to receive input numeric or character information and generate key signal inputs related to user settings and function control of the electronic device. Specifically, the user input unit 507 includes a touch panel 5071 and other input devices 5072. Touch panel 5071, also referred to as a touch screen, may collect touch operations by a user on or near it (e.g., operations by a user on or near touch panel 5071 using a finger, stylus, or any suitable object or attachment). The touch panel 5071 may include two parts of a touch detection device and a touch controller. The touch detection device detects the touch direction of a user, detects a signal brought by touch operation and transmits the signal to the touch controller; the touch controller receives touch information from the touch sensing device, converts the touch information into touch point coordinates, sends the touch point coordinates to the processor 510, and receives and executes commands sent by the processor 510. In addition, the touch panel 5071 may be implemented in various types such as a resistive type, a capacitive type, an infrared ray, and a surface acoustic wave. In addition to the touch panel 5071, the user input unit 507 may include other input devices 5072. In particular, other input devices 5072 may include, but are not limited to, a physical keyboard, function keys (e.g., volume control keys, switch keys, etc.), a trackball, a mouse, and a joystick, which are not described in detail herein.
Further, the touch panel 5071 may be overlaid on the display panel 5061, and when the touch panel 5071 detects a touch operation thereon or nearby, the touch operation is transmitted to the processor 510 to determine the type of the touch event, and then the processor 510 provides a corresponding visual output on the display panel 5061 according to the type of the touch event.
